Lenox Wealth Management's Q3 2017 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2017, Lenox Wealth Management held 534 positions worth $291M, up 18% from $247M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 49% of the portfolio.

Lenox Wealth Management deployed $35.2M of net new capital in Q3 2017, opening 35 new positions and adding to 199 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Essex Property Trust: 1,912 shares worth $489K.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 17% of assets, down from 19%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Staples and Technology.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Berkshire Hathaway Class B, an estimated $1.55M trimmed.
